Job Requirements

  • must be 18 years in age or older
  • must pass DOT physical, drug screen and criminal background check
  • must possess valid DOT medical card
  • strict adherence to safety requirements and procedures as outlined in the employee handbook
  • willingness to work in a team environment and assist co-workers or supervisors with other duties as required
  • must display a professional and courteous attitude to co-workers, supervisors, and the general public at all times
  • must maintain current driver's license that meets state requirements, i.e., CDL, Class A and/or B Driver with air brake endorsement, possible hazmat and tanker endorsements
  • MVR must meet company and DOT standards
  • must be willing to travel and work away from home when required
  • must be willing to work nights and weekends when necessary
  • individuals are required to wear personal protective equipment (PPE) in designated operations and production areas as stated by OSHA and/or MSHA
  • compliance with all OSHA and/or MSHA regulations

Job Qualifications

  • minimum of a high school diploma or general education degree (GED) required
  • minimum of 2 years experience driving mixer truck preferred
  • must have a valid driver's license and must maintain a CDL A or CDL B license
  • ability to learn operational knowledge and skills of mixer truck and related equipment
  • ability to read, write and do basic mathematical calculations
  • ability to operate equipment safely and efficiently under a variety of working conditions
  • ability to understand and follow verbal and written instructions
  • ability to effectively communicate verbally and in writing
  • ability to work effectively in a team environment as well as independently with attention to detail
  • ability to operate heavy and complex equipment requiring skill and judgment
  • must be familiar with securing heavy equipment and other over-dimensional loads
  • ability to professionally interact with customers, collect payments and assist with issues
  • ability to operate various types of heavy equipment that may include truck/car, ready mix truck, loader/backhoe, and haul truck

Job Duties

  • perform daily pre/post trip inspections with appropriate documentation in compliance with DOT guidelines
  • load and unload equipment or materials
  • monitor various gauges during operation of vehicle
  • maintain daily vehicle mileage logs
  • properly follow all company policies and procedures to ensure a safe working environment
  • obey applicable laws and follow dispatch instructions
  • assure product quality to the best of ability
  • perform minor servicing and maintenance of equipment
  • keep vehicle clean and in orderly condition
  • regular and predictable attendance at assigned times is required
  • other duties as assigned
